    We really need a Movie about Kentaro Miura’s life. I can guarantee you that everyone has consumed SOME form of Berserk in their life. Things like Dragons Dogma and Dark souls, in the movie Brightburn the director admitted the logo is based on the brand of the sacrifice, it really created and kick started a world of dark fantasy and monstrous beasts. Before Kentaro began berserk he worked with Jyoji Morikawa, creator of Hajime No Ippo. Jyoji even admitted that for Miuras age his art skills were far beyond his, he saw Miura’s sketchbook and asked Miura about his drawings, and he had thousands of drawings of a man with a mechanical arm and a piece of iron too big to be called a sword. Miura said that when he felt he was ready he would show the world his creation. sounds like it would do amazing as a movie. He had the idea of Berserk since he was 18, maybe even younger, and he carried that all the way through to his death.
